M.E. passed away on Wednesday, February 17th, at Our Lady of Lourdes Hospital, with the love and support of her son Dale and her daughters, Debbie and Donna. Born in Monroe on April 20, 1929, M.E. lived in various places around the world and was able to travel to so many others. She spent the last season of her life in Lafayette, in the company of her children, grandchildren and great grandchildren. She was preceded in death by her parents, John and Evelyn Johnson and by her husband, Stewart M. Scott Jr. She is survived by her three children, son Calvin Dale Smith residing in Ontario, Canada; daughters, Debbie Frame residing in Lafayette with her husband David, Donna Bulliard residing in Broussard with her husband Marcel; her stepson, Don Scott residing in Monroe; stepdaughter, Kay Scott of Baton Rouge. She is also survived by her grandchildren, Sara Renee Smith, Philip Caronia III, Calvin David Frame, Chris Bulliard, Jeffrey Bulliard, Randall Bulliard, Alexis DeJean, Caroline Scott, Holly Scott, and Stewart Scott; seven great grandchildren; her nieces, Brenda Broussard and Cheryl Smith; and her first cousin, Donald Wallace. The Memorial Service on Friday will be conducted by the Pastor of Trinity Bible Church, Dennis Malcolm. The service will be preceded by a time of visitation from 2:00 PM until 3:00 PM. Friends and family are invited to attend to share their remembrances of M.E. and to celebrate her life and to give thanks for her faith. Interment will be held on Wednesday, February 24, 2016 in the Mulhearn Memorial Park Cemetery in Monroe, LA at noon.
